- The distance between Beja, Portugal and Segou, Mali is approximately 2,743 km or 1,704 mi.
- To reach Beja in this distance one would set out from Segou bearing 356.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Beja bearing 356° or N .
- Beja has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Segou has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Beja is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Segou is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 11.8 °C (21.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.2 °C (11.2°F) more in Beja.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 49.9 mm (2 in) less which is equivalent to 49.9 l/m² (1.22 US gal/ft²) or 499,000 l/ha (53,346 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.4° lower in Beja than in Segou.
